BNB overview

BNB is the native asset used for gas and staking within BNB Chain, including the EVM-compatible BNB Smart Chain. Applications on BNB Smart Chain use BNB to pay execution fees, and validators secure the chain through staked authority. The BNB asset is therefore tied to this specific network, protocol, or issuer function rather than to a generic cryptocurrency category.

BNB Smart Chain uses Proof of Staked Authority, with an active validator set producing and validating blocks. BNB is non-inflationary in the chain documentation, while protocol and scheduled burn mechanisms remove BNB from circulation. A distinguishing feature is that BNB combines the gas role of an EVM-compatible chain with Proof of Staked Authority and explicit burn mechanisms. That design differs from proof-of-work issuance and from tokens that merely run as application contracts. What network uses BNB as its native coin?

BNB is the native gas and staking asset of BNB Smart Chain.

How does BNB Smart Chain reach consensus?

BNB Smart Chain uses Proof of Staked Authority, under which a validator set produces and validates blocks.

How can BNB supply change?

The official chain documentation describes BNB as non-inflationary, while Auto-Burn and protocol burn mechanisms remove units from circulation.
